The contracting authority requires that economic operators submitting a tender to prove a registration in accordance with the law of the country of residence, showing that the economic operatoris legally constituted, is not in any of the situations of cancellation of establishment, and that it has the professional capacity to carry out the activities covered by the framework agreement.

The manner by which the fulfillment of the requirement can be demonstrated: the DUAE to the economic operators participating in the award procedure with information related to their situation. Dothe supporting documents proving the fulfillment of the obligations assumed by the DUAE, respectively the certificate issued by the ONRC or, in the case of foreign tenderers, equivalent documents issued in the country of residence shall be submitted at the request of the contracting authority only by the tenderer ranked first in the ranking drawn up following the application of the award criterion, according to the provisions of art. 132 par. (2) of the rules

1) If two or more offers rank first in the ranking (obtained the same score), the contracting authority will designate the winner with the lowest price; 2) How to make the contractual changes. The contracting authority will allow modification / adaptation of the contractual provisions in the event of the occurrence of some legislative changes having impact asthe agreement / framework contract / subsequent contract and if the changes / adaptations are minor and do not change the economic equilibrium of the framework agreement / subsequent contract in favor of the contractor.

The contracting parties are entitled, during the fulfillment of the subsequent contract, to agree modifying and / or completing its clauses, without organizing a new procedureassignment, with the agreement of the parties, without affecting the general character of the contract, within the limits provided by art. 221 and art. 222 of the Law no. 98/2016, corroborated with the provisions of art. 164 and art. 165 of the norms.

Non-material changes are the only changes to the subsequent contract that can be made without the organization of a new award procedure.u must in no way and in any way affect the outcome of the award procedure by canceling or diminishing the competitive advantage on the basis of which the service provider has been declared winner in the award procedure.
